KATHMANDU, March 31: Central Investigation Bureau (CIB) of Nepal Police arrested a man with a tiger’s hide from Dhangadhi Sub-Metropolitan City on Friday.



The arrested has been identified as 18-year-old Sanam Jayakar of Parshuram Municipality-4, Dadeldhura.

Similarly, police on Thursday arrested two people with a bear’s bile from the Capital.


They are Bam Bahadur Tamang, 34, of Bhojpur Sampang-6 and Surya Shrestha, 32, of Lampantar-4, Sindhuli.


Police have sent Jayakar to District Forest Office, Kailali and Tamang and Shrestha to District Forest Office, Kathmandu for further action.
